Boost for the ladies ahead of cup semi’


Alnwick Town Ladies, after some indifferent results, got back on track at the weekend with an emphatic win over Norton & Stockton Ancients Reserves in the North East Women’s League.
Alnwick won 10-0 at St James’ Park with four goals each for Stafford and Darling and one each from Barrett and McFall.
Player of the Match was Josie Foster.
The win maintain’s Alnwick’s mid-table position with 23 points from their 14 games played.
